As Nvidia Declines and Trump Upholds Tariffs, the S&P 500 Climbs but Gains are Restrained

When President Donald Trump said that tariffs on Canada and Mexico will go forward as planned, in addition to higher taxes on China, stocks increased Thursday despite market trepidation.

When Nvidia released its fourth-quarter earnings, the market bellwether stock fell. The S&P 500 saw an increase of 0.3%. By 236 points, or 0.6%, the Dow Jones Industrial Average increased. By 0.1%, the Nasdaq Composite increased.

Following the expiration of the one-month moratorium, Trump declared in a post on Truth Social that the proposed 25% tariffs on Canada and Mexico would go into effect on March 4.

The two nations have not yet sufficiently reduced the flow of drugs across the border, according to Trump. The president added that China will be subject to an additional 10% tax on top of the 10% tariffs already imposed by the United States.
